#37d0a0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#37d0a0 is composed of 21.6% red, 81.6% green and 62.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.1%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 161.2 degrees, a saturation of 61.9% and a lightness of 51.6%. #37d0a0 color hex could be obtained by blending #6effff with #00a141.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#37d0a0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020605 is the darkest color, while #f6fd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#37d0a0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838484 is the less saturated color, while #11f6ae is the most saturated one.
